Tips

  1. Make sure your fingers are spread apart and your forearms are place a shoulders width apart to insure a good base.
  2. If you are a beginner, make sure you have someone there to help you. This spotter could also help with getting your legs against the wall.
  3. Make sure to keep your back and legs straight and against the wall.
